Summary/Abstract: Five and a half thousand years ago on the land, which is now called the Ukraine, on the edge of the ancient civilized world, there stood cities. They were the oldest cities in Europe, erected by a people whose name is unknown. Archaeologists name it the Tripolye culture after a small village in the Kiev area. Precisely here, about a hundred years ago, first sites of this culture were uncovered by V.V. Khvoyko. For seventy years several generations of archaeologists excavated Tripolye settlements but they did not know that one of the main and intriguing secrets was lying under their feet. There were huge settlements or proto-cities which had an area of hundreds hectares. Supposedly, everything or almost everything is known about the Tripolye culture. Nobody could imagine that in the end of the 20th century it is possible to discover a new civilization which is totally unknown for historians.
